Ottawa, 1905. xvii,459pp. plus frontispiece portrait and many plates. With separate slipcase containing six folding illustrations, ten folding maps, and two folding profiles. Book: original brown cloth, gilt. Minor edge wear and slight bumping to boards. Internally clean. Maps: contemporary three-quarter calf and cloth. Minor wear, but clean. Overall very good. "An account of a topographical survey of a portion of the Selkirk Mountains adjacent to the line of the Canadian Pacific railway...accompanied by a brief review of travel and exploration, of previous surveys and of mountaineering in these regions." A substantial work, seldom found with the map portfolio. LOWTHER 1548. EDWARDS & LORT 3998.

Since 1975, William Reese Company has served a large international clientele of collectors and private and public institutions in the acquisition of rare books and manuscripts and in collection development.

With a catalogued inventory of over thirty thousand items, and a general inventory of over sixty-five thousand items, we are among the leading specialists in the fields of Americana and world travel, and maintain a large and eclectic inventory of literary first editions and antiquarian books of the 18th through 20th centuries.
